Transaction 95651a99bbfe071e0e0dbdaf3d8c9c3a2e4a1de0e7f8ce9733754661a0a03600
1 Input
2 Outputs
- 95651a99bbfe071e0e0dbdaf3d8c9c3a2e4a1de0e7f8ce9733754661a0a03600:0
- 95651a99bbfe071e0e0dbdaf3d8c9c3a2e4a1de0e7f8ce9733754661a0a03600:1
value 134340771
address mkYLZz4e8S5i7qZnyC2xYusHonwnPwa8s8
value 100000
address mpVXMKTiwkwjmF6rg6y1gPaQHAvm7EmaBf